What is Biodiesel Fuel?
Derived from natural oils, Biodiesel is a domestic, renewable fuel for diesel engines. It is legal for use in both highway and non-road diesel vehicles.
Contrary to popular belief, Biodiesel is not simply raw vegetable oil, but motor fuel made from any vegetable oil (such as soybean oil, canola oil, sunflower oil, or recycled cooking oils) or animal fats, by means of a chemical process which removes the glycerin from the oil.
The refining process, called “esterification”, employs an industrial alcohol (ethanol or methanol) and a catalyst (a substance which enables a chemical reaction) to convert the oil into a fatty-acid methyl ester fuel.
Biodiesel is a fuel for any diesel engine. It is made from natural oils rather than petroleum. Biodiesel performs similarly to regular diesel fuel and can be used with no modifications to the diesel engine or the vehicle. Biodiesel offers huge advantages, but like any fuel has some limitations. It is affected by cold weather to a greater extent than diesel fuel and typically delivers 2 to 3 percent lower fuel mileage.
Bottom Line: If It Runs On Diesel, It Will Run On Biodiesel.

What Equipment Do I Need to Make Biodiesel Fuel?
Safety Gear: Because you’ll be using chemicals to refine your oil, you should always be sure you’re wearing protective safety gear before starting the process. Safety goggles, gloves, protective apron and boots are essential.
Chemicals: The Biodiesel fuel-making process requires methanol, sulfuric acid and catalyst along with air-tight storage containers for each.

Fuel Filter: The fuel filter works to filter and remove water from the fuel. Because initial use of Biodiesel can release deposits previously accumulated on tank walls and pipes, it’s recommended that the fuel filter be changed after the first tank of Biodiesel.
Fuel Pump: The fuel pump provides safe, efficient transfer of the fuel to your engine. Consider models that are heavy duty with thermal overload protection, strainer and automatic nozzle for easy fuel transfer.
Fuel Pre-heaters: A Biodiesel fuel can sometimes gel, either due to cold temperatures or because it’s been produced from heavily saturated fats such as waste oil from restaurants. Fuel pre-heaters work to effectively keep Biodiesel from solidifying.
Biocides: Biocides are an additive designed to stop the growth of microorganisms in your fuel, thus helping preserve the life of stored Biodiesel.
Synthetic Polymer Fuel Lines: The solvent properties of Biodiesel can result in a slow degradation of rubber fuel lines over the course of months and sometimes years. Therefore, it is beneficial to use Synthetic Polymer Fuel Lines when it comes time for replacement.
